Optimizing Pyrazolopyrimidine Inhibitors of Calcium Dependent Protein Kinase 1 for Treatment of Acute and Chronic Toxoplasmosis
Janetka, James W.,Hopper, Allen T.,Yang, Ziping,Barks, Jennifer,Dhason, Mary Savari,Wang, Qiuling,Sibley, L. David
supporting information, p. 6144 - 6163 (2020/07/10)
Calcium dependent protein kinase 1 (CDPK1) is an essential Ser/Thr kinase that controls invasion and egress by the protozoan parasite Toxoplasma gondii. The Gly gatekeeper of CDPK1 makes it exquisitely sensitive to inhibition by small molecule 1H-pyrazolo

A Facile Synthesis of Dialkoxycarbonylketene-, Dicyanoketene-, and Alkoxycarbonyl(cyano)ketene Ethylene Acetals
Neidlein, Richard,Kikelj, Daniel
, p. 981 - 983 (2007/10/02)
Dicyanoketene-, dialkoxycarbonylketene-, and alkoxycarbonyl(cyano)ketene ethylene acetals can be conveniently prepared by reaction of malononitrile, dialkyl malonates and alkyl cyanoacetates with 2-chloroethyl chloroformate.
